While it's a drastic departure from City's current away colour scheme, which consists of a predominantly black front with maroon sleeves, it's not the first time that they have used a claret design.
You may remember seeing Nicolas Anelka, Joey Barton and Richard Dunne sporting a similar colour scheme with City's third kit in the 2002/2003 season.
Older supporters may even recall the below number and it's noted that the club may be paying homage to the away kit sported during the 1989/90 season, when they finished 14th in the First Division with Howard Kendall as manager, a world away from the Etihad-fuelled powerhouse of today.
